Hey all, I recently acquired an sdm1000 mic and would like to wire it up to an RCI2950. I see conflicting wiring schemes on the internet and there were two different models with different color wires. I have the black,white,red, blue,green,orange, and shield version.

Re: SDM1000 mic info needed
well the rci 2950 requires the following from any mic:
1-shield
2-audio-
3-transmit
4-receive
5-channel up if equipped on mic
6-channel down if equipped on mic
since the ranger sdm1000 does have channel up and down the below code should work for you my book only lists that mic as having black/red/white/blue/green and yellow as well the shield - so i would GUESS that your orange is the substitute for the yellow wire, if thats true try this code:
1 Shield/Black
2 Red
3 White
4 Blue
5 Yellow <----------- sub your orange wire in here
6 Green
please let me know if it works and i can make the notation in my book
